It's not going well now. They're burning the sport down already. 

The new "have-nots" are going to be pissed. I get that. And the remaining "haves" are not going to be in good shape when the sport is burnt down either. If the sport becomes a watered-down NFL but without any semblance of parity, I'm guessing that everyone outside of 12-15 fan bases will disengage. At that point, the money dries up, because the ratings dry up, and everyone's screwed. 

The desire to make everything in the sport about "crowning a single objective champion" when you have 120-130 teams--110+ or so which have no shot at it at all--screwed it up. NIL and the transfer portal further eliminated those 110+ teams from caring. 

So who cares about the 11-20th teams who used to get their way but are now the have-nots?

Of course they need wins. 

Even as the schedule gets tougher, people's expectations don't go down. And as much as this sport is a churning cauldron of unrealistic people, it's not measured in championships or playoff spots. It's measured in wins. 10-2 and 8-4s and such. And when you break off fully, a bunch of 8-4 teams become 2-10 teams. And that would be a real problem for them. It's gonna be a problem when they become 7-5/6-6. (The NFL gets around this by having the consolation of the draft. CFB's only consolation is a new HC)

And that's the way it is. Even as the sport is nationalized, the majority of folks are mostly focused on their team. And most fanbases are not dwelling in this particular strain of nihilism and you seem to be so enchanted by at the moment.
